Book excerpt: Excerpt from Maryland Colonization Journal, Vol. 3: July, 1845 Mr. Latrobe then referred to the differences which had at times taken place between the Societies and the Missionaries which were now happily, terminated, and proceeded to detail circumstances shewing the internal economy of the Colony, trials in Court, &c. &c., which space does not per mit us to follow. It is not pretended, said Mr. L., that we have a Colony in which every man is rich, in which there are not instances of individual poverty and want. With the materials which have been employed to found Maryland in Liberia, it would be strange if it were otherwise. But, looking to the general result, there is no room for any other emotion than that of profound gratitude to Heaven for the signal favour with which the operations of the Society have been blessed.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Maryland Colonization Journal, Vol. 3: October, 1846 The other is, that many thousands of the natives choose to r'esi-de within the territory of Liberia, for the sake of security and peace, which they, there enjoy; and willingly obey the laws Of the colony. And although hostile and formidable attacks were made on the colonists when they were few in number, so that their preservation must be ascribed to the remarkable interposition of Providence - yet, now, they are free from all apprehension of danger, and are at peace with all the surrounding tribes. And so high is the opinion entertained of the government of the colony, that frequently the disputes among the neighbouring tribes are referred to them for arbitration.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Maryland Colonization Journal, Vol. 3: March, 1846 Several objects will be attained by sending the model, instead of the vessel, to Africa - The outlay of her construction will be a service to the Colony employment will be given to a good many of the colonists while she is being built: the building will be a matter Of pride and interest the example may lead to the building of others; and especially an admirable model will be furnished, to serve for future use. At the old Colony, vessels have been built for several years past. The one, whose model is now sent out, will be the first built at Cape Palmas.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Maryland Colonization Journal, Vol. 3: June, 1846 The best road that I have seen in Africa is that extending from Harper to Mount Tubman, a distance of more than three miles. It is not a small path, but a well-beaten wagon road. On riding out to Mount Vaughan, I met an oxcart, filled with rice. Two small oxen and two donkeys were attached to the cart. This was the first thing of the kind that I have seen in this country. There are several small riding horses in the Colony, and several donkeys.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Maryland Colonization Journal, Vol. 3: January, 1847 The very ground work Of African colonization, from first to last, both among its slavery and anti-slavery supporters, has been, that equality, poli tical or social, between the African and Caucasian race can never exist on this continent, that the lesser, of course the weaker race, must serve or flee. This doctrine, however kindly and judiciously announced, must always to the one party be extremely unpalatable, but when reiterated and enlarged Upon by excited declaimers, with a free application of epithets, not the most flattering to the coloured people, its only effect is to steel their hearts against all that can promise them or their posterity nationality or worldly good - to generate in them the Nolt' me' tangere of a most inveterate character.
